Both the GPT-4 model and two resident physicians independently classified the nodules using ultrasound images. The diagnostic accuracy of the resident physicians was determined by calculating the average of the individual accuracy rates of the two physicians and this was compared with the performance of the GPT-4 model.<\/jats:p><\/jats:sec><jats:sec><jats:title>Results<\/jats:title><jats:p>The GPT-4 model correctly identified 367 out of 632 malignant nodules (58.07%) and 343 out of 513 benign nodules (66.86%). Resident physicians identified 467 malignant (73.89%) and 383 benign nodules (74.66%). There was a statistically significant difference in the classification of malignant nodules (<jats:italic>p<\/jats:italic>\u202f&amp;lt;\u202f0.001) and benign nodules (<jats:italic>p<\/jats:italic>\u202f=\u202f0.048) between the GPT-4 model and residents. GPT-4 performed better for larger nodules (&amp;gt;1\u202fcm) at 65.38%, compared to 53.77% for smaller nodules (\u22641\u202fcm, <jats:italic>p<\/jats:italic>\u202f=\u202f0.004).
